Foundation Repair Cost - The typical cost range for foundation repair services varies from approximately $2,000 to $7,000, depending on the extent of the damage. Minor repairs may be closer to the lower end, while extensive underpinning or stabilization can increase costs significantly. Local pros can provide detailed estimates based on specific needs.
Crack Repair Expenses - Repairing cracks in a foundation generally costs between $500 and $2,500. Smaller cracks often fall on the lower end, whereas larger or multiple cracks may require more extensive work. Prices can vary based on the size and location of the cracks.
Soil Stabilization Costs - Soil stabilization or reinforcement services typically range from $3,000 to $10,000, depending on the size of the affected area and soil conditions. Proper stabilization is essential for long-term foundation stability and can involve different techniques that influence pricing.
Additional Service Fees - Costs for additional foundation repair services like piering or underpinning can add $1,500 to $4,000 or more to the overall project. What are common signs of foundation issues? Indicators include visible cracks in walls or floors, uneven or sloping floors, doors and windows that stick or don’t close properly, and gaps around window frames or doorways.
How long does foundation repair typically take? The duration varies depending on the extent of the damage and the repair method, but most projects can be completed within a few days to a week.
Are foundation repairs disruptive to daily life? Repairs can involve some level of disturbance, such as noise or limited access to certain areas, but experienced contractors aim to minimize inconvenience during the process.
What causes foundation problems in homes? Common causes include soil settlement, poor drainage, plumbing leaks, or expansive clay soils that shift with moisture levels.
